Is the 'Manchurian Candidate' based on a real story?

The 'Manchurian Candidate' was inspired by real - world concerns. During the Cold War, there were genuine fears about mind control techniques being developed by rival powers. These fears led to the creation of the story, which while fictionalized, was rooted in the paranoia of the era. There were reports and speculations about various psychological experiments that could potentially be used for such nefarious purposes, and the story took these ideas and wove them into a thrilling narrative.

What are the real - life events that inspired 'The Manchurian Candidate'?

The Cold War paranoia was a major inspiration. The fear of enemy countries using mind - control techniques on soldiers or political figures. There were some unsubstantiated reports of such attempts during that time which led to the idea behind the story.

What are the Real - Life Events that Inspired 'The Manchurian Candidate'?

The Cold War paranoia about mind control was a major inspiration. There were reports and rumors of various countries, especially the Soviet Union, experimenting with ways to manipulate the minds of people. These led to the creation of the idea of a person being turned into a sleeper agent like in the story.
